~repos /website
git clone https://pyrossh.dev/repos/website.git
木 Personal website of pyrossh. Built with astrojs, shiki, vite.
dd32498b
—
pyrossh 2 weeks ago
update deps
- bun.lock +14 -10
- ec.config.mjs +0 -2
- package.json +5 -6
bun.lock
CHANGED
|
@@ -1,23 +1,22 @@
|
|
|
1
1
|
{
|
|
2
2
|
"lockfileVersion": 1,
|
|
3
|
+
"configVersion": 0,
|
|
3
4
|
"workspaces": {
|
|
4
5
|
"": {
|
|
5
6
|
"name": "my-astro-project-using-bun",
|
|
6
7
|
"dependencies": {
|
|
7
8
|
"@appzic/astro-reset-css": "^1.2.0",
|
|
8
|
-
"@astrojs/rss": "^4.0.12",
|
|
9
|
-
"@astrojs/sitemap": "^3.4.1",
|
|
10
|
-
"alchemy": "^0.77.5",
|
|
11
9
|
"astro": "^5.9.0",
|
|
12
10
|
"astro-color-scheme": "^1.1.5",
|
|
13
11
|
"astro-expressive-code": "^0.41.3",
|
|
14
12
|
"astro-icon": "^1.1.5",
|
|
15
|
-
"expressive-code-color-chips": "^0.1.2",
|
|
16
13
|
"pretty-bytes": "^7.1.0",
|
|
17
14
|
"simple-git": "^3.27.0",
|
|
18
15
|
"timeago.js": "^4.0.2",
|
|
19
16
|
},
|
|
20
17
|
"devDependencies": {
|
|
18
|
+
"@astrojs/rss": "^4.0.12",
|
|
19
|
+
"@astrojs/sitemap": "^3.4.1",
|
|
21
20
|
"@aws-sdk/client-s3": "^3.932.0",
|
|
22
21
|
"@aws-sdk/client-sts": "^3.932.0",
|
|
23
22
|
"@iconify-json/material-symbols": "^1.2.39",
|
|
@@ -25,6 +24,7 @@
|
|
|
25
24
|
"@playwright/test": "^1.52.0",
|
|
26
25
|
"@tauri-apps/cli": "^2.9.1",
|
|
27
26
|
"@types/bun": "^1.3.2",
|
|
27
|
+
"alchemy": "^0.77.5",
|
|
28
28
|
"diff2html": "^3.4.52",
|
|
29
29
|
},
|
|
30
30
|
},
|
|
@@ -534,7 +534,7 @@
|
|
|
534
534
|
|
|
535
535
|
"@types/nlcst": ["@types/nlcst@2.0.3", "", { "dependencies": { "@types/unist": "*" } }, "sha512-vSYNSDe6Ix3q+6Z7ri9lyWqgGhJTmzRjZRqyq15N0Z/1/UnVsno9G/N40NBijoYx2seFDIl0+B2mgAb9mezUCA=="],
|
|
536
536
|
|
|
537
|
-
"@types/node": ["@types/node@
|
|
537
|
+
"@types/node": ["@types/node@17.0.45", "", {}, "sha512-w+tIMs3rq2afQdsPJlODhoUEKzFP1ayaoyl1CcnwtIlsVe7K7bA1NGm4s3PraqTLlXnbIN84zuBlxBWo1u9BLw=="],
|
|
538
538
|
|
|
539
539
|
"@types/react": ["@types/react@19.2.5", "", { "dependencies": { "csstype": "^3.0.2" } }, "sha512-keKxkZMqnDicuvFoJbzrhbtdLSPhj/rZThDlKWCDbgXmUg0rEUFtRssDXKYmtXluZlIqiC5VqkCgRwzuyLHKHw=="],
|
|
540
540
|
|
|
@@ -780,8 +780,6 @@
|
|
|
780
780
|
|
|
781
781
|
"expressive-code": ["expressive-code@0.41.3", "", { "dependencies": { "@expressive-code/core": "^0.41.3", "@expressive-code/plugin-frames": "^0.41.3", "@expressive-code/plugin-shiki": "^0.41.3", "@expressive-code/plugin-text-markers": "^0.41.3" } }, "sha512-YLnD62jfgBZYrXIPQcJ0a51Afv9h8VlWqEGK9uU2T5nL/5rb8SnA86+7+mgCZe5D34Tff5RNEA5hjNVJYHzrFg=="],
|
|
782
782
|
|
|
783
|
-
"expressive-code-color-chips": ["expressive-code-color-chips@0.1.2", "", { "peerDependencies": { "@expressive-code/core": "^0.37.1" } }, "sha512-6vGCN1KjZQhHAd4U5kxvoBgBRB8kjcdY5bjJgzzJ29mlGpSp4tt5eI8zvLzSUIxwHmu65fATdGW82tNQM2befw=="],
|
|
784
|
-
|
|
785
783
|
"exsolve": ["exsolve@1.0.7", "", {}, "sha512-VO5fQUzZtI6C+vx4w/4BWJpg3s/5l+6pRQEHzFRM8WFi4XffSP1Z+4qi7GbjWbvRQEbdIco5mIMq+zX4rPuLrw=="],
|
|
786
784
|
|
|
787
785
|
"extend": ["extend@3.0.2", "", {}, "sha512-fjquC59cD7CyW6urNXK0FBufkZcoiGG80wTuPujX590cB5Ttln20E2UB4S/WARVqhXffZl2LNgS+gQdPIIim/g=="],
|
|
@@ -1436,10 +1434,14 @@
|
|
|
1436
1434
|
|
|
1437
1435
|
"@rollup/pluginutils/estree-walker": ["estree-walker@2.0.2", "", {}, "sha512-Rfkk/Mp/DL7JVje3u18FxFujQlTNR2q6QfMSMB7AvCBx91NGj/ba3kCfza0f6dVDbw7YlRf/nDrn7pQrCCyQ/w=="],
|
|
1438
1436
|
|
|
1439
|
-
"@types/
|
|
1437
|
+
"@types/fontkit/@types/node": ["@types/node@22.15.3", "", { "dependencies": { "undici-types": "~6.21.0" } }, "sha512-lX7HFZeHf4QG/J7tBZqrCAXwz9J5RD56Y6MpP0eJkka8p+K0RY/yBTW7CYFJ4VGCclxqOLKmiGP5juQc6MKgcw=="],
|
|
1438
|
+
|
|
1439
|
+
"@types/tar/@types/node": ["@types/node@22.15.3", "", { "dependencies": { "undici-types": "~6.21.0" } }, "sha512-lX7HFZeHf4QG/J7tBZqrCAXwz9J5RD56Y6MpP0eJkka8p+K0RY/yBTW7CYFJ4VGCclxqOLKmiGP5juQc6MKgcw=="],
|
|
1440
1440
|
|
|
1441
1441
|
"@types/tar/minipass": ["minipass@4.2.8", "", {}, "sha512-fNzuVyifolSLFL4NzpF+wEF4qrgqaaKX0haXPQEdQ7NKAN+WecoKMHV09YcuL/DHxrUsYQOK3MiuDf7Ip2OXfQ=="],
|
|
1442
1442
|
|
|
1443
|
+
"@types/yauzl/@types/node": ["@types/node@22.15.3", "", { "dependencies": { "undici-types": "~6.21.0" } }, "sha512-lX7HFZeHf4QG/J7tBZqrCAXwz9J5RD56Y6MpP0eJkka8p+K0RY/yBTW7CYFJ4VGCclxqOLKmiGP5juQc6MKgcw=="],
|
|
1444
|
+
|
|
1443
1445
|
"alchemy/fast-xml-parser": ["fast-xml-parser@5.3.2", "", { "dependencies": { "strnum": "^2.1.0" }, "bin": { "fxparser": "src/cli/cli.js" } }, "sha512-n8v8b6p4Z1sMgqRmqLJm3awW4NX7NkaKPfb3uJIBTSH7Pdvufi3PQ3/lJLQrvxcMYl7JI2jnDO90siPEpD8JBA=="],
|
|
1444
1446
|
|
|
1445
1447
|
"ansi-align/string-width": ["string-width@4.2.3", "", { "dependencies": { "emoji-regex": "^8.0.0", "is-fullwidth-code-point": "^3.0.0", "strip-ansi": "^6.0.1" } }, "sha512-wKyQRQpjJ0sIp62ErSZdGsjMJWsap5oRNihHhu6G7JVO/9jIB6UyevL+tXuOqrng8j/cxKTWyWUwvSTriiZz/g=="],
|
|
@@ -1450,6 +1452,8 @@
|
|
|
1450
1452
|
|
|
1451
1453
|
"boxen/chalk": ["chalk@5.4.1", "", {}, "sha512-zgVZuo2WcZgfUEmsn6eO3kINexW8RAE4maiQ8QNs8CtpPCSyMiYsULR3HQYkm3w8FIA3SberyMJMSldGsW+U3w=="],
|
|
1452
1454
|
|
|
1455
|
+
"bun-types/@types/node": ["@types/node@22.15.3", "", { "dependencies": { "undici-types": "~6.21.0" } }, "sha512-lX7HFZeHf4QG/J7tBZqrCAXwz9J5RD56Y6MpP0eJkka8p+K0RY/yBTW7CYFJ4VGCclxqOLKmiGP5juQc6MKgcw=="],
|
|
1456
|
+
|
|
1453
1457
|
"cheerio/undici": ["undici@6.21.3", "", {}, "sha512-gBLkYIlEnSp8pFbT64yFgGE6UIB9tAkhukC23PmMDCe5Nd+cRqKxSjw5y54MK2AZMgZfJWMaNE4nYUHgi1XEOw=="],
|
|
1454
1458
|
|
|
1455
1459
|
"csso/css-tree": ["css-tree@2.2.1", "", { "dependencies": { "mdn-data": "2.0.28", "source-map-js": "^1.0.1" } }, "sha512-OA0mILzGc1kCOCSJerOeqDxDQ4HOh+G8NbOJFOTgOCzpw7fCBubk0fEyxp8AgOL/jvLgYA/uV0cMbe43ElF1JA=="],
|
|
@@ -1482,8 +1486,6 @@
|
|
|
1482
1486
|
|
|
1483
1487
|
"rollup/fsevents": ["fsevents@2.3.3", "", { "os": "darwin" }, "sha512-5xoDfX+fL7faATnagmWPpbFtwh/R77WmMMqqHGS65C3vvB0YHrgF+B1YmZ3441tMj5n63k0212XNoJwzlhffQw=="],
|
|
1484
1488
|
|
|
1485
|
-
"sitemap/@types/node": ["@types/node@17.0.45", "", {}, "sha512-w+tIMs3rq2afQdsPJlODhoUEKzFP1ayaoyl1CcnwtIlsVe7K7bA1NGm4s3PraqTLlXnbIN84zuBlxBWo1u9BLw=="],
|
|
1486
|
-
|
|
1487
1489
|
"string-width-cjs/emoji-regex": ["emoji-regex@8.0.0", "", {}, "sha512-MSjYzcWNOA0ewAHpz0MxpYFvwg6yjy1NG3xteoqz644VCo/RPgnr1/GGt+ic3iJTzQ8Eu3TdM14SawnVUmGE6A=="],
|
|
1488
1490
|
|
|
1489
1491
|
"string-width-cjs/strip-ansi": ["strip-ansi@6.0.1", "", { "dependencies": { "ansi-regex": "^5.0.1" } }, "sha512-Y38VPSHcqkFrCpFnQ9vuSXmquuv5oXOKpGeT6aGrr3o3Gc9AlVa6JBfUSOCnbxGGZF+/0ooI7KrPuUSztUdU5A=="],
|
|
@@ -1500,6 +1502,8 @@
|
|
|
1500
1502
|
|
|
1501
1503
|
"unicode-trie/pako": ["pako@0.2.9", "", {}, "sha512-NUcwaKxUxWrZLpDG+z/xZaCgQITkA/Dv4V/T6bw7VON6l1Xz/VnrBqrYjZQ12TamKHzITTfOEIYUj48y2KXImA=="],
|
|
1502
1504
|
|
|
1505
|
+
"vite/@types/node": ["@types/node@22.15.3", "", { "dependencies": { "undici-types": "~6.21.0" } }, "sha512-lX7HFZeHf4QG/J7tBZqrCAXwz9J5RD56Y6MpP0eJkka8p+K0RY/yBTW7CYFJ4VGCclxqOLKmiGP5juQc6MKgcw=="],
|
|
1506
|
+
|
|
1503
1507
|
"vite/fsevents": ["fsevents@2.3.3", "", { "os": "darwin" }, "sha512-5xoDfX+fL7faATnagmWPpbFtwh/R77WmMMqqHGS65C3vvB0YHrgF+B1YmZ3441tMj5n63k0212XNoJwzlhffQw=="],
|
|
1504
1508
|
|
|
1505
1509
|
"wrangler/@cloudflare/unenv-preset": ["@cloudflare/unenv-preset@2.7.10", "", { "peerDependencies": { "unenv": "2.0.0-rc.24", "workerd": "^1.20251106.1" }, "optionalPeers": ["workerd"] }, "sha512-mvsNAiJSduC/9yxv1ZpCxwgAXgcuoDvkl8yaHjxoLpFxXy2ugc6TZK20EKgv4yO0vZhAEKwqJm+eGOzf8Oc45w=="],
|
ec.config.mjs
CHANGED
|
@@ -1,8 +1,6 @@
|
|
|
1
1
|
import { defineEcConfig } from 'astro-expressive-code';
|
|
2
|
-
import { pluginColorChips } from 'expressive-code-color-chips';
|
|
3
2
|
|
|
4
3
|
export default defineEcConfig({
|
|
5
|
-
plugins: [pluginColorChips()],
|
|
6
4
|
// themes: [],
|
|
7
5
|
shiki: {
|
|
8
6
|
langAlias: {
|
package.json
CHANGED
|
@@ -4,7 +4,7 @@
|
|
|
4
4
|
"type": "module",
|
|
5
5
|
"version": "0.0.1",
|
|
6
6
|
"engines": {
|
|
7
|
-
"bun": "1.3.
|
|
7
|
+
"bun": "1.3.3"
|
|
8
8
|
},
|
|
9
9
|
"scripts": {
|
|
10
10
|
"tauri": "tauri",
|
|
@@ -19,26 +19,25 @@
|
|
|
19
19
|
},
|
|
20
20
|
"dependencies": {
|
|
21
21
|
"@appzic/astro-reset-css": "^1.2.0",
|
|
22
|
-
"@astrojs/rss": "^4.0.12",
|
|
23
|
-
"@astrojs/sitemap": "^3.4.1",
|
|
24
|
-
"alchemy": "^0.77.5",
|
|
25
22
|
"astro": "^5.9.0",
|
|
26
23
|
"astro-color-scheme": "^1.1.5",
|
|
27
24
|
"astro-expressive-code": "^0.41.3",
|
|
28
25
|
"astro-icon": "^1.1.5",
|
|
29
|
-
"expressive-code-color-chips": "^0.1.2",
|
|
30
26
|
"pretty-bytes": "^7.1.0",
|
|
31
27
|
"simple-git": "^3.27.0",
|
|
32
28
|
"timeago.js": "^4.0.2"
|
|
33
29
|
},
|
|
34
30
|
"devDependencies": {
|
|
31
|
+
"@types/bun": "^1.3.2",
|
|
32
|
+
"@astrojs/rss": "^4.0.12",
|
|
33
|
+
"@astrojs/sitemap": "^3.4.1",
|
|
35
34
|
"@aws-sdk/client-s3": "^3.932.0",
|
|
36
35
|
"@aws-sdk/client-sts": "^3.932.0",
|
|
37
36
|
"@iconify-json/material-symbols": "^1.2.39",
|
|
38
37
|
"@iconify-json/mdi": "^1.2.3",
|
|
39
38
|
"@playwright/test": "^1.52.0",
|
|
40
39
|
"@tauri-apps/cli": "^2.9.1",
|
|
41
|
-
"
|
|
40
|
+
"alchemy": "^0.77.5",
|
|
42
41
|
"diff2html": "^3.4.52"
|
|
43
42
|
}
|
|
44
43
|
}
|